3 Joe Lykken | 48th Annual Fermilab Users Meeting! 6/10/15 P5 plan in a nutshell!
• Continue U.S. commitment and leading roles in the LHC • Build a neutrino program at Fermilab that will attract the world community • Continue U.S. leading efforts in dark matter, dark energy, and cosmic microwave background • Pursue the Fermilab-based muon program • Invest in the accelerator and detector technologies that we will need in the future
It is a feature of this plan that the major components reinforce each other

5 Joe Lykken | 48th Annual Fermilab Users Meeting! 6/10/15 Overarching Fermilab science strategy: diverse with flagship!
• A world class laboratory with the resources on the scale of Fermilab or CERN should have a diverse particle physics program and a flagship project…with the closing of the Tevatron Fermilab lost its flagship…however strong diverse program emerging – LHC, cosmic, muons, SBL & LBL neutrinos, accelerator science
• No flagship project “started,” but progress rapid and focused on a FY17 construction start for DUNE/LBNF – Increase users by ~1,000 – Drives upgrade of accelerator complex…incrementally – Success will enhance significantly our “global” reputation
